Our crew will meet at the Old Venetian port and welcome you on board, where you will be given a briefing about safety and boat handling. We set our sails and we are off to our destination,the beautiful Dia island. Dia is an uninhabited island, 7 nautical miles north of Heraklion and is protected by the Natura 2000 project because of its biodiversity. Our trip there lasts almost one hour. We set anchor on either Agios Georgios or Panagia bay (depending on the weather conditions), which are located on the south part of the island. Both coves are known for their green, crystal waters surrounded by the protected wildlife, like the medium sized “Falco Eleonorae” the lizard Podarcis erchardii schiebeli, the wild goat Capra Aegagrus Cretica and the monkseal Monachus monachus. For about one hour and a half, you will enjoy these beautiful water with swimming, snorkeling or sunbathing! Cool refreshments and seasonal fruit will accompany the fun! After your lunch and perhaps after a quick dive, we will set our sails back to Heraklion port. Have your cameras ready in case we spot some of our lovely mammal friends, the dolphins.
